Pricing

TierPriceWhat's included
Free$0Core features with monthly usage caps.
Starter / Pro$6/moHigher limits, priority output, removed watermarks, and core team features.
Team / BusinessCustomSSO, audit logs, dedicated support, and volume pricing for organizations.
